System.StrUtils.SoundexInt

提供: RAD Studio API Documentation
移動先: 案内検索

Delphi

function SoundexInt(const AText: string; ALength: TSoundexIntLength): Integer;

C++

extern DELPHI_PACKAGE int __fastcall SoundexInt(const System::UnicodeString AText, TSoundexIntLength ALength = (TSoundexIntLength)(0x4));

プロパティ

種類 可視性 ソース ユニット
function public
System.StrUtils.pas
System.StrUtils.hpp
System.StrUtils System.StrUtils

説明

文字列を,音声値を表す整数に変換します。

SoundexInt 関数は,Soundex アルゴリズムを使用して,AText で指定した文字列を音声表現に変換します。この音声表現では,各文字が,類似した音素の 6 つのファミリーのうちの 1 つを表します。その後,この関数は,音声表現中の最初の ALength で指定した長さの Soundex コードを一意に表す整数を返します。

メモ:  TSoundexIntLength 型は,1 から 8 までの整数を表します。これは,整数戻り値のサイズが,最終的な表現で使用できる Soundex コードの数を制限するからです。

関連項目